THIS VIDEO: Greg and I are tourists for a day in Cavendish and Summerside, PEI (Prince Edward Island). We check out Anne of Green Gables museum and show you the restaurants and shops in Avonlea village, we share what we ate at Moo Moo BBQ Grilled Cheesery, enjoy lobster rolls at Dave's Lobster, and Samuel's Coffee along with a tour of the village, and then we take a drive to Summerside PEI to try the famous Holman's Ice Cream. A local, family owned gourmet ice cream shop that opened in a historic house in 2016.
